quote:

2 litre bottle
1 cup of water
1/4 cup of brown sugar

HOW:
1. Cut the plastic bottle in half.
2. Mix brown sugar with hot water. Let cool. When cold, pour in the bottom half of the bottle.
3. Add the yeast. No need to mix. It creates carbon dioxide, which attracts mosquitoes.
4. Place the funnel part, upside down, into the other half of the bottle, taping them together if desired.
5. Wrap the bottle with something black, leaving the top uncovered, and place it outside in an area away from your normal gathering area.


This shite attracts flies like a mofo if you want to set up a perimeter for an a-salt. It's supposed to be for mosquitoes, but we set this in the back yard and bagged 50 flies per day. I'm ordering a bug a salt to frick these mofos up.
